What is john malkovich burn this?

"Burn This" is a play written by Lanford Wilson, which premiered on Broadway in October 1987. The play features the character Pale, a troubled and volatile young man who develops a complicated emotional relationship with Anna, a dancer mourning the loss of her roommate and former lover, Robbie.

John Malkovich starred as Pale in the original Broadway production of "Burn This," earning critical acclaim and a Tony Award nomination for his performance. Malkovich is a well-known American actor, producer, and director who has appeared in numerous successful films, including "Dangerous Liaisons," "In the Line of Fire," "Being John Malkovich," and "Bird Box."

"Burn This" explores themes of grief, love, and personal identity, and has been praised for its raw emotional intensity and powerful performances. The play has been revived several times on Broadway and has been adapted for film and television.
